Zeigler Named MAC West Division Player of the Week
11/28/2011 12:00:00 AM | Men's Basketball
MOUNT PLEASANT – Central Michigan University sophomore Trey Zeigler (Mount Pleasant, Mich./Mount Pleasant HS) was named the Mid-American Conference West Division Player of the Week by the league office on Monday.
It marks the first time in his career that he has earned the honor.
Zeigler was named to the all-tournament team at the Great Alaska Shootout after leading CMU to a 2-1 record and fourth-place finish. CMU was 3-1 overall on the week.
Zeigler averaged 17.5 points, 7.3 rebounds and 2.8 assists per game while shooting .538 from the floor.
He recorded his third double-double of the season against Dartmouth and had a pair of 20-point games. The guard took game-high scoring honors in two of the four contests and also dished out a career-high tying six assists at Pepperdine.
The Chippewas are idle until Saturday, Dec. 3 when they travel to Atlantic 10 Conference foe Temple.
